Take one Team Medics Pouch:


Open to reveal 3 compartments:

Top compartment:
Swiss Army waterbottle,2 mugs and a spoon

Middle compartment:
Fold down Mug and coffee/soup sachets

Bottom compartment:
Ti Foldable stove, Meths, Trangia burner, lighters
